  • Must visit

Aquarium

Major aquarium with a maritime museum section, historic displays and a walk-through tunnel. A strong all-weather visit near the harbour.

  • Must visit

Chillida Leku

Museum dedicated to sculptor Eduardo Chillida, set in a large garden with monumental works. Combines art, landscape and a quieter side of the area.

  • Recommended

Tabakalera

Contemporary art centre focused on Basque and international work. It is worth visiting for exhibitions, architecture and a calmer cultural stop in the city.

Euro (€)

Moderate for Spain: pintxos and coffee are reasonable, but central hotels and popular dining can cost more than in many comparable Spanish cities.

Average meal costs

Budget
€8-15 for a casual meal or pintxos.
Mid-range
€20-35 per person for a mid-range meal.
Fine dining
€60+ per person for fine dining.
Coffee
€1.80-3.50 for coffee.

Tipping culture

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% in restaurants for very good service; small change in cafés; taxi tips are optional, often just rounding up.

In Donostia-San Sebastian, visitors can enjoy surfing at Zurriola Beach, embark on a pintxo tour in the lively bars of the Old Town, and ride the funicular to Monte Igueldo for breathtaking views and amusement park excitement. Exploring the Aquarium with its diverse marine life and ocean tunnel is a must, as is attending a concert or event at the Kursaal Congress Centre. Notable sights include the scenic La Concha Beach, the historic Old Town with its Basque architecture, Monte Igueldo, San Telmo Museoa focused on Basque culture, and the Miramar Palace with its beautiful gardens.
Three to four days is ideal to explore Donostia-San Sebastian, allowing time to enjoy its beaches, savour the famous pintxos, and visit key attractions like the Old Town and Mount Urgull.
